£000’s wasted by District Council on Blackfriars Housing Development
Rother District Council’s £21 million Blackfriars housing scheme in Battle has drawn scrutiny over soaring costs, contract changes, and funding gaps. The 200 homes were promoted as “future-proofed for the transition to Zero Carbon", as the infrastructure budget swelled to £21 million, questions remain about how those ambitions will be delivered amid redesigns, market pressures, and public concern.
